%description
fntsample is a program for making font samples that show Unicode coverage of
the font. The samples are similar in appearance to Unicode charts.

Features:
* Support for various font formats using FreeType library, including TrueType,
  OpenType, and Type1.
* Creation of samples in PDF and PostScript format.
* Addition of outlines with Unicode block names for PDF samples.
* Selection of code ranges to show in charts.
* Comparisons of two font files with highlighting of added glyphs.
